如何将 bzr 分支导入 git?

如何将 bzr 分支导入 git?

我非常习惯使用 git,有没有一种简单的方法可以在提交后将内容从 bzr 导入/导出到 git 并返回 bzr?

答案1

看一眼git-bzr。请注意 readme 底部的 Python 重写,这可能会更好地集成。还请注意,git-bzr 周围有相当多的分支/衍生品,但这似乎是最近才活跃的;您可能想在 github 上寻找类似的东西。

答案2

bzr-git有一个“bzr dpush”命令,可用于将分支推送到 git,还有一个“bzr pull”命令,可用于将新的 Git 提交拉入 bzr 分支。

答案3

我按照说明进行操作Jeff Hodges 的博客,使用裁缝进行迁移。bzr 网站上提供的迁移工具列表

答案4

您可以添加并使用“git 为 mercurial 和 bazaar 提供桥梁支持”

现在,您可以毫不费力地克隆 mercurial 和 bazaar 存储库。原始存储库将像任何 git 存储库一样被跟踪……您可以拉取,实际上也可以推送。实际上,您甚至不会注意到这个远程存储库不是 git 存储库。您可以创建和推送新分支……一切皆有可能。

相关内容